Wakefield And District Down's Syndrome Support Group
We offer support to families and we run activities and events to enable those families to have fun, develop friendships and, ultimately, to support each other. We aim to make a positive difference by improving understanding and positive awareness of Down's syndrome in our community through social media, training/information for families and professionals and through participation in local events.

When was Wakefield And District Down's Syndrome Support Group registered as a charity?
Wakefield And District Down's Syndrome Support Group was registered with the Charity Commission for England and Wales on 20 February 2014 as charity number 1155866. It has been registered for 12 years.
Who runs Wakefield And District Down's Syndrome Support Group?
Wakefield And District Down's Syndrome Support Group is governed by a board of 9 trustees. The chair of trustees is ANN-MARIE SHEARD. Trustees are legally responsible for the charity's governance and are listed in full on its profile.
Where does Wakefield And District Down's Syndrome Support Group operate?
Wakefield And District Down's Syndrome Support Group operates in City Of Wakefield, as recorded in its Charity Commission filing.
